What is the cheapest month to fly from Raleigh to Scranton?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Raleigh to Scranton,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Raleigh to Scranton is April, where tickets cost $288 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are January and December,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$471 and $429 respectively.

  • Do I need a passport to fly between Raleigh and Scranton?

    No, a passport isn't needed to fly from Raleigh to Scranton. However, local authorities might ask for an official ID.

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Raleigh to Scranton?

    Raleigh and Scranton are both served by 1 main airport. You will leave Raleigh from Raleigh-Durham and will be arriving at Wilkes-Barre Scranton.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Raleigh to Scranton?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Scranton with an airline and back to Raleigh with another airline. Booking your flights between Raleigh and AVP can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
